- The distance between Golden, Bc, Canada and Putao, Myanmar is approximately 10,646 km or 6,616 mi.
- To reach Golden, Bc in this distance one would set out from Putao bearing 20.8° or NNE and follow the great circles arc to approach Golden, Bc bearing 149.7° or SSE .
- Golden, Bc has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b) whereas Putao has a humid subtropical climate with dry winters (Cwa).
- Golden, Bc is in or near the subpolar rain tundra biome whereas Putao is in or near the warm temperate wet forest biome.
- The mean temperature is 16 °C (28.8°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 14.5 °C (26.1°F) more in Golden, Bc.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ly oce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 3510.2 mm (138.2 in) less which is equivalent to 3510.2 l/m² (86.15 US gal/ft²) or 35,102,000 l/ha (3,752,637 US gal/ac) less. About 1/8 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 23.9° lower in Golden, Bc than in Putao.
